EPA penalizes grocery chains for selling illegal disinfectants in 3 states
EPA says Chedraui USA must pay a penalty of $472,369 for selling unregistered disinfectants with toxic chemicals at El Super and Smart & Final stores in three states.

Mountain View kitchen fire causes thousands in damages, displaces two
(KRON) – Two people were displaced after an apartment fire in Mountain View, according to the Mountain View Fire Department. Fire units were dispatched to the residential apartment complex on the 300 block of Escuela Avenue on Nov. 30 at 9:38 p.m. after a report of a stove fire. The building’s occupants...
